❑ AFQ table
Actions → Functions → Design Opportunities
Action
Function
Questions / Design Opportunities
Insert film
paper into
camera
The user…
The camera…
VERB + object
The most basic,
so we have lots
of room for ideas
All the ideas for
HOW we could
do it
Receives film paper
Holds in place
Could we put the paper in sideways?
Make sure glove can fit opening!
Where will the aperture be? >> paper placement
Could we use magnets? Which orientation?
